LED ASPs for handset backlighting fall 10-15% in January

The average selling prices (ASPs) of LEDs utilized in handset backlight applications have dropped by 10-15% since this January, according to Epistar.


With the improvements of light efficiency and brightness, ASPs of LED products decline about 20%-30% per year, but ASPs remained strong since the third quarter of 2007 due to surging growth in demand for small- to- medium panel backlighting and supply running tight, according to LED makers. However, LED chip makers have faced price reductions since the first quarter of 2008 due to the slow season approaching and customers' inventory policy affecting the number of new orders.


Some customers have requested a 10% price reduction in ASPs of handset-use LED applications and the ASPs may decline further in March due to increased orders and shipments, according to LED packaging makers. However, the ASPs are expected to rebound in the third quarter due to growing demand for small-to-medium panel backlighting applications, they added
